From b28a3cef416fcfb92fbb9ea7fd3c71df52c6c9fc Mon Sep 17 00:00:00 2001
From: Jakub Jelen <jjelen@redhat.com>
Date: Mon, 12 Aug 2024 19:02:14 +0200
Subject: [PATCH] openpgp: Do not accept non-matching key responses
When generating RSA key pair using PKCS#15 init, the driver could accept
responses relevant to ECC keys, which made further processing in the
pkcs15-init failing/accessing invalid parts of structures.
Thanks oss-fuzz!
https://bugs.chromium.org/p/oss-fuzz/issues/detail?id=71010
Signed-off-by: Jakub Jelen <jjelen@redhat.com>
CVE: CVE-2024-8443
Upstream-Status: Backport [https://github.com/OpenSC/OpenSC/commit/b28a3cef416fcfb92fbb9ea7fd3c71df52c6c9fc]
Signed-off-by: Zhang Peng <peng.zhang1.cn@windriver.com>
---
src/libopensc/card-openpgp.c | 10 ++++++++++
1 file changed, 10 insertions(+)
